Area13..Very nice camper...I have always thought pickup campers have had very generic floor plans, up until Host came out with there very different ones..I really have not seen one I did not like.
The one issue I do have is the lack of actual weights on them, like TC campers buyers guide, is a pretty good take on the weights of different campers,at least in the ball park, from what I can tell.I cannot find actual ready to camp weights on the Host line of truck campers.First thought at looking at the pictures, is there really heavy...Dry weights listed are as everyone knows,misleading.

We looked at one of these at Tom's Camperland in Mesa, we really liked the layout, it had the two recliners with the L-shaped dinette and the bedroom area was actually pretty easy to get in and out of! We like how you don't have to do the shuffle when getting dressed or cooking, plus the dry bath. The Host campers seem to tick most of our boxes also, but we are pretty happy with our AF811 for now!
